1. A Journey Through Time: The Historical Significance of Petra
Before diving into the night-time magic, let’s set the scene. Petra, located in Jordan, is a UNESCO World Heritage site and one of the most famous archaeological sites in the world. Known as the “Rose City” due to the color of the stone from which it is carved, Petra was once the capital of the Nabataean Kingdom, a civilization that thrived between the 4th century BC and the 2nd century AD. 🏺
The Petra by Night tour offers a unique perspective on this ancient city, illuminating its grandeur and mystery in a way that daytime tours simply cannot. As you make your way through the Siq, the narrow canyon that leads to the Treasury, the flickering candlelight casts shadows that dance along the walls, creating an atmosphere that is both eerie and enchanting. 🕯️
2. The Experience: What to Expect When You Visit Petra at Night
So, what exactly does the Petra by Night experience entail? For starters, it’s not just about seeing the site in a different light; it’s about feeling it. The tour begins with a walk through the Siq, where the walls are lined with hundreds of candles. The sound of footsteps echoing off the stone and the gentle breeze carrying the scent of the desert add to the mystique. 🏞️
Once you reach the Treasury, the main attraction, the sight is breathtaking. The building, with its intricate carvings and majestic façade, is illuminated in such a way that it almost seems to come alive. The tour guides provide fascinating insights into the history and architecture of Petra, making the experience educational as well as awe-inspiring. 🏰
3. Tips for Making the Most of Your Petra by Night Adventure
To truly savor the Petra by Night experience, there are a few tips to keep in mind. First, wear comfortable shoes, as the tour involves quite a bit of walking. Bring a jacket or sweater, as it can get chilly in the evening. And don’t forget your camera – capturing the magic of Petra under the stars is a must! 📸
Lastly, try to arrive early if possible. The tour starts promptly at sunset, and arriving early allows you to enjoy the ambiance without the rush of the crowd. The quiet moments before the tour officially begins can be some of the most magical. 🕗
4. Beyond Petra: Exploring More of Jordan’s Rich Cultural Heritage
While Petra by Night is undoubtedly a highlight, Jordan has much more to offer. From the Dead Sea to Wadi Rum, the country is a treasure trove of natural beauty and historical significance. Each location tells a story, and each story adds another layer to the rich tapestry of Jordanian culture. 🌅
For those interested in a deeper dive, consider exploring other UNESCO sites like the ancient city of Jerash or the Crusader castle of Kerak. Each site offers a glimpse into a different era, allowing visitors to connect with the past in meaningful ways. 🏰📚
